    Legal representative: Parliament will discuss the "amnesty" next week after amending it covered


    Iraq suspended 03/25/2016 11:18

    Parliamentary Legal Committee confirmed the submission of the amnesty law for the presidency of the parliament after it traced back to some modifications.

    He said committee member Ibtisam al-Hilali's "Eye of Iraq News," "The committee has completed its amendments on the general amnesty and sent to the Presidency in the House bill, noting that the" law of the Council will be put for discussion during the hearings next week. "

    He said al-Hilali, said that "five paragraphs not included in the law, which is both the convicts to Article (4) terrorism, kidnapping, drugs and incest, as" included seven paragraphs in it. "

    The amnesty law of "controversial laws" that Parliament still has difficulty in passing, where the Council completed the first and second readings to him, before traced back to the committee in question, amid fears of a repeat of the experience of general amnesty in 2008 and received from opposition
